Can Resistance Enhance Selection of Treatment? (CREST)
NCT00262717 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 338
Last updated 2025-06-26
Summary
To compare two commercially available platforms for assessment of HIV drug resistance to determine which provides superior virological results.
We hypothesise that one test will be significantly superior to the other.
